Inside the workshop, we keep the process simple but precise. Freshness matters more than big machinery or fancy automation. After cleaning away soil and debris, roots get sliced thick enough to hold their volatile flavors but thin enough to dry evenly. We refuse to shortcut sun drying when weather allows, as hot air ovens can never capture the subtle aromatics of natural curing. These old-school habits keep the scent and active compounds as the roots move to extraction.
Once dried, shredded slices are soaked in pure water—never in denatured alcohol—and heated gently. We watch the temperature closely, aiming for a balance: high enough to pull out the maximum berberine and alkaloids, low enough to leave the delicate flavonoids intact. Experienced hands know the point when the pungent bitterness turns to a syrupy aroma, thickening in steel tanks. We filter the liquid until it’s clear. This isn’t some one-size-fits-all extract, and that matters.
Standardization makes a difference for those who trust our powder for herbal formulas, supplements, or custom blends. Most batches clock berberine content above 8.5%—a figure we double-check by HPLC before anything leaves the facility. Some competitors chase higher numbers with aggressive solvent extraction or chemical enrichment, but this usually strips away the broad alkaloid spectrum that makes Coptidis unique. With us, full-spectrum means every batch carries not just berberine, but jatrorrhizine and palmatine in their natural proportions.
In the market, Rhizoma Coptidis Extract comes in many forms and grades. Most traders sell on paper specs—fine powder, 10:1 extract ratios, high berberine claims. We’ve seen laboratories offer almost pure berberine, but that turns this ancient herb into just another white crystalline isolate. This isn’t what clinics or classic formula makers look for, and our conversations with TCM doctors affirm that full-spectrum powder works differently.
Our most popular model is a brownish-yellow powder with mesh sizes ranging from 80 to 200, blending easily with water or excipients. We maintain moisture content below 5.0% to guard against caking and spoilage, especially for export clients dealing with humid climates. Every lot runs through microbial and heavy-metal testing—not only because regulations demand it, but because poor handling can turn a valuable herb into a risk.
We also see clients asking for custom ratios such as 5:1 or 20:1. These ratios speak to how much raw root gets condensed into a kilo of finished powder. Some prefer lower ratios for mild formulations, others want strong powders that deliver higher active levels in a small capsule. Either way, we believe numbers mean little unless extraction techniques keep the compound profile true to traditional use.

Competing manufacturers may promise higher ratios, but chasing these extremes can warp the product. Running extraction cycles beyond a certain point depletes aromatics, reduces palmatine, and sometimes introduces solvent residues. Over-concentration can even anger regulators, who see over-purified extracts as isolates more akin to pharmaceuticals than to genuine plant powders. We stick to a middle path: enough concentration to ensure potency, but not so much that the product loses its traditional fingerprint.

Stability is a major concern in this trade, especially for products crossing borders and climates. Rhizoma Coptidis alkaloids break down under sunlight and moisture. Instead of dousing powders with preservatives, we invest in vacuum-packing, multi-layer moisture barriers, and temperature-controlled storage. Faux-fresh repacking at the destination leads only to disappointed end-users and unwanted variability. We educate importers and local handlers on the best ways to maintain integrity, and encourage them to reject product that arrives with broken seals or staleness.
